RESUMO

Frequently, stresses are caused by changes in adaptations of prosthetic structures to the implant besides marginal disajustment between prosthetic fixing and rehabilitations. This study aims to evaluate the distribution of compression and traction of the prosthetic sustainers and the methalic framework melted in cromocobalt alloy, through the monoblock technic simulating a fixed prosthesis implantsupported on 06 implants at the distance of 10mm between each other and with bilateral cantilever extending to 20mm, placed along the mandibular oclusal line curvature, with the extensometry technic. In each abutment there have been placed four strain guages and one in each cantilever, in configuration "Wheatstone Bridge", after all components having been fixed to the framework, it was submitted to a mechanic essay with vertical pressing charges of 150Ncm, checking quantitatively the accurate result through extensometry. Results have been obtained by using the greatest values of axial charge registered in each place of applied force,. On nearest pillars to the charge, It has been obtained a greater degree of compression (fulcrum), what corresponds to the amount of oclusal force applied to the equalizing stress force. And, therefore, the most distant pillars will assimilate a negative deformation ( compression) or a positive deformation (traction, seesaw), proportional to the lever arm
